Sinclar Group temporarily curtails operations at three sawmills in Canada

Sinclar Group Forest Products Ltd. announced it is curtailing its lumber operations at Apollo Forest Products in Fort St. James, Lakeland Mills in Prince George, Canada, and Nechako Lumber Co. in Vanderhoof, for two weeks, effective January 30th.

“There are factors outside of our control that are having a detrimental impact on our business,” said Sinclar President Greg Stewart. “Regrettably, it is necessary to curtail our lumber operations at this time.”

Weak market conditions and constraints on an economical fibre supply are having a significant negative impact across the British Columbia forest industry.

The Premium Pellet operation will continue to run, and Lakeland will continue to provide heat to the Prince George Downtown Renewable Energy System.

Sinclar Group Forest Products is a family-owned and operated group of companies in the Central Interior of British Columbia that produce lumber, homes, engineered wood products and wood pellets.
